AMD가 야심차게 발표한 차세대 GPU "라데온 R9 퓨리X"







The Fiji based Radeon R9 Fury X has a TDP set at, give or take, 275 Watts. You power it by using two 8-pin PCI-Express graphics card headers. Combined they allow for 300 Watts with another 75 Watts coming from the PCIe slot, so that is 375 Watts of power delivery at your disposal, handy for a bit of tweaking I'd say.
 


If we zoom in a little, up top you will see a micro DIP switch; the card has two BIOSes, both equal. One simply functions as a fail-safe should you mess up a firmware flash. So there's no 'uber' performance mode like the 290X had here.
 

 

 


The backside of the card is also completely covered. So yeah, thermal imaging is going to be a challenge today! So the backside is a thing of preference for many of you these days. It allows for a better protected product in the critical areas yet also makes a card more sturdy. 
 

 

The Fury X comes with a liquid cooling solution, from this perspective it might look a little bulky, but it's all good really. The radiator is roughly 4cm thick and with the fan on top of it, 6.5 cm. It follows the standard 120mm form factor so this unit will be easy to house pretty much anywhere inside a chassis.

So yeah - it's all a little bit different alright, a closed-loop liquid cooling solution, the smaller form factor, some new lighting options. But overall from an aesthetic point of view, a very decently designed product if you ask me.
 


Here we can see the connectors; as explained, Display Port 1.2a x 3, one HDMI 1.4a connector and thus lacking is a DVI connector. Obviously, Eyefinity works here perfectly fine as well, DP recommended of course. It might be a very interesting card with which to set up a desktop multi-monitor setup.



The card comes with two BIOSes. One stores a STANDARD reference BIOS, and another one that functions as fail-safe. The micro DIP switch is just above the Radeon logo. Below the two 8-pin PCI-Express power connectors you can see an array of red LEDs, these are in fact GPU load indicators. All red for full GPU utilization, half of them at 50% load. Once in IDLE or zero power mode, one LED will remain active. 
 

 
Now, if you looked closely (and as a Guru3D reader we assume you already did), you would have noticed a set of micro switches on the back side as well. This card has phase load LEDs, full load and a series of LEDs will activate. These switches allow you to configure the colors. 8+1 LEDs located above the PCIe power connectors that indicate the intensity level of the GPU operation. For example, during a typical gaming session all 8 LEDs will be lit, and while typically idling on the desktop a single LED will be lit. These 8 LEDs are user configurable to either red and/or blue by the physical dip-switch located on the back side of the graphics card. The 1 green LED located alongside the 8 LEDs indicates when the graphics card is in ZeroCore Power operation.

 

 

The top side Radeon logo is now LED lit as well, especially for PCs with a side see-through panel, that will be very visible

GCN 1.2 아키텍처

  • Engine has Dual Geometry engines / Asynchronous Compute engines
  • 16 render backends / 64 color ROPs per clock cycle / 256 Z/Stencil ROPs per clock
  • Engine ties to 2048 KB R/W L2 cache (Upto16 64 KB L2 cache partition)
  • Fiji GPU has up-to 64 Compute Units
  • 4 Geometry processors (4 primitives per clock cycle)
  • 64 Pixel Output/clock
